update : 2015.11.03
php.shukuma.com

검색:
 
 
변경점

변경점

이 확장의 클래스/함수/메소드에 다음과 같은 변경이 이루어졌습니다.

General Changelog for the ext/mysql extension

This changelog references the ext/mysql extension.

Changes to existing functions

The following list is a compilation of changelog entries from the ext/mysql functions.

VersionFunctionDescription
5.3.0mysql_db_query이 함수는 E_DEPRECATED 주의를 발생합니다.
 mysql_escape_stringE_DEPRECATED 주의가 발생합니다.
5.0.0mysql_fetch_object다른 객체로 반환할 수 있는 기능 추가
4.3.7mysql_list_tables이 함수는 배제되었습니다.
4.3.0mysql_connectclient_flags가 추가되었다.
 mysql_escape_string이 함수의 사용은 권장하지 않는다. 대신, mysql_real_escape_string를 사용하라.
 mysql_pconnectclient_flags가 추가되었다.
4.2.0mysql_connectnew_link가 추가되었다.
4.0.6mysql_db_query본 함수는 더 이상 존재하지 않으며 권장되지 않는다. 대신, mysql_select_db과 mysql_query를 사용하라.
3.0.10mysql_connectserver에 ":/path/to/socket" 를 사용할 수 있게 되었다.
 mysql_pconnectserver에 ":/path/to/socket" 를 사용할 수 있게 되었다.
3.0.0mysql_connectserver에 ":port" 를 사용 가능하게 되었다.
 mysql_pconnectserver에 ":port" 를 사용 가능하게 되었다.

Global ext/mysql changes

The following is a list of changes to the entire ext/mysql extension.

버전 설명
5.5.0

This extension has been deprecated. Connecting to a MySQL database via mysql_connect(), mysql_pconnect() or an implicit connection via any other mysql_* function will generate an E_DEPRECATED error.

5.5.0

All of the old deprecated functions and aliases now emit E_DEPRECATED errors. These functions are:

mysql(), mysql_fieldname(), mysql_fieldtable(), mysql_fieldlen(), mysql_fieldtype(), mysql_fieldflags(), mysql_selectdb(), mysql_createdb(), mysql_dropdb(), mysql_freeresult(), mysql_numfields(), mysql_numrows(), mysql_listdbs(), mysql_listtables(), mysql_listfields(), mysql_db_name(), mysql_dbname(), mysql_tablename(), and mysql_table_name().